Course details

Name: Conservation farming
Description:A course designed for farmers who have an interest in conservation farming.
Cost:After NSW Government subsidy $360 GST free.
Course aims:

A course to provide growers and extension practitioners with the necessary skills, knowledge and resources to effectively get conservation farming practices right, across NSW.

Learning outcomes:
  • To help make informed decisions about machinery required for conservation farming.
  • To help improve conservation farming practices.
  • To help understand the physical, chemical and biological aspect associated with soil, as the natural resource base.
  • To help understand the management aspects required with alternative crops like pulses, canola etc.
Length:1 day
Course program/structure: 
Resources and method of delivery:

Participants receive course notes and manual.

This course is delivered using indoor and out door instruction.
Accreditation:

This course has been mapped to the national unit of competency RTE5524A
